To help reduce risk and improve the certainty of a successful project we can work with you to complete a feasibility study and / or produce a conceptual design. A feasibility study helps to define the scope of your M&E project. This leads to a clear understanding of your project needs, considering technical, economic, compliance, safety and environmental aspects. This information helps you determine whether or not to proceed with the project and what format it should take. Taking place at the start of the design process, a conceptual design can be created to transform your design ideas or concept into visual media, specifically outlining the forms and functions of your concept. This allows you to test and validate ideas before you commit to a project and helps you avoid costly mistakes and wasted time.

    We frequently start a project with an engineering design site survey, as it helps gather essential information and requirements to inform the design phase. This helps you and our engineers and designers make informed decisions and meet project objectives while managing constraints and risks effectively. These surveys vary depending on the specific needs and complexities of an M&E project. We often utilise reverse engineering to recreate an installation to a matching, or improved, specification. Rather than being designed from scratch, reverse engineering allows us to understand the original design intent, learn from the existing design for your new design project, improve an installation, or convert paper design drawings into digital 3D CAD data. Visualisations show the project infrastructure as a finished project. They are used to allow your project stakeholders to communicate ideas, evaluate designs, identify potential issues, and make informed decisions before your installation begins.

    Our engineering design team working with our M&E project team are skilled in CAD drafting, project planning, estimating, document management and control. The engineering design documentation vary for each project, dependant on your needs but typically consist of a project description, project specifications, significant design decisions, diagrams of final project implementation, bill of materials, assembly information, and maintenance information.

  • Finite Element Analysis (FEA)

    Finite Element Analysis (FEA) is a computational technique that is used to simulate and analyse the behaviour of structures and systems under various operating conditions and constraints. Finite Element Analysis is a powerful tool that helps us better understand how a structure or system will perform in the real world. This better understanding of the behaviour of your structures, under different loading conditions, helps us to optimise our designs for factors such as strength, reliability, durability, simplicity, weight, cost and safety. Our in-house designed steelwork is typically subject to static stress analysis.
